Laundry list of harvest problems for Iowa farmer

A north central Iowa farmer formed a laundry list of problems looking back at the harvest of 2017.

Wayne Fredericks, a corn and soybean grower from Osage, says the frustration began when weather delayed the start of harvest to mid-October.

“The 17th was our starting time period, and we were fraught with frustration getting our original combine going.  We had electrical gremlins in it, and I guess there’s nothing worse than trying to diagnose electrical problems in a mid-2000’s vintage combine.”

Fredericks traded for a newer combine, and tells Brownfield harvest got a little smoother.
